Discover more about Walcott House

Walcott House, nestled in the vibrant heart of Castries, stands as a testament to the rich cultural tapestry of St. Lucia. This intimate museum, dedicated to the life and works of Nobel Laureate Derek Walcott, invites visitors to explore the artistic legacy of one of the Caribbean's most revered poets. As you enter this charming space, you're greeted by an array of personal artifacts, photographs, and literary works that chronicle Walcott's profound connection to his homeland and its people. The ambience of the house, with its traditional architecture and scenic surroundings, enhances the experience, allowing guests to feel the essence of St. Lucian life and creativity. Beyond the exhibits, Walcott House often hosts literary events, exhibitions, and workshops that celebrate local culture, making it a living hub for artists and writers. Visitors can immerse themselves in the vibrant discussions about literature, art, and the island's socio-cultural context, which adds an enriching layer to your visit. The museum's knowledgeable staff are more than willing to share insights and anecdotes that bring Walcott's work to life, ensuring a memorable experience for both literature enthusiasts and casual tourists alike.
